How to Play Blackjack (3 Hand)
Blackjack (3 Hand) is a card game, not a traditional slot. The main goal is to beat the dealer. You must get a hand value closer to 21 without going over. The unique mechanic here is playing three hands at once.
Players have a flexible betting range. Bets can be placed from 20 up to 1000 per hand. This accommodates both cautious players and high rollers. The game’s incredible 99.6% RTP gives it a very low house edge. The volatility for this game has not been disclosed by the developer. However, blackjack is typically a low-volatility game. Volatility and Payouts in This Blackjack (3 Hand) Review
The volatility for this game has not been disclosed by the developer. Generally, blackjack offers a low-volatility experience. This means wins tend to be frequent but smaller. It allows for longer play sessions on a modest bankroll. The risk-to-reward profile is very stable. It suits players who prefer strategy over chasing huge jackpots.
The hit frequency for this game has not been disclosed by the developer. Your win rate depends on skill and the cards dealt. Furthermore, there are no bonus rounds to trigger. The maximum win for this game has not been disclosed by the developer. Payouts follow standard blackjack rules. A regular win pays 1:1, while a natural blackjack pays 3:2. This game offers a low-risk profile with steady returns.
